### Item 7 — Static-analysis baseline

Confirm the Lintwarden baseline file for the Cobblewick repo has not grown since last quarter. New suppressions require a linked ticket and justification comment. Regenerating the baseline wholesale is prohibited. Spot-check five entries for validity. Any unexplained additions must be reported to the owner named below.

approver of yajef-fajef = Oliwyn Silion Kasok Kasox

**First day — night shift checklist: bike cage & parking gates**

On arrival, park only in bays 40–55; the main gates run on sensors after 22:00, but the exit gate needs a manual release before 05:00. The bike cage sits behind Block D at Wrenhall Works and stays locked at all times — do not prop the door. Both the cage and the manual gate release use the same keypad. Enter the following code.

door code, kawip-bagap: bdg-HQEWH-4

Subject: Handover — StallSense occupancy feed releases

Welcome aboard. You now own deploys for the garage occupancy feed. Cadence is weekly, Wednesdays. Build from the release branch, run the sensor-replay check, and confirm occupancy counts match the staging garage fixture within 2%. Rollbacks are one command; doc is in the ops folder. Don't deploy during the morning peak. Consumers verify every feed bundle signature, so nothing unsigned ever ships. Sign releases with the key below until your own is provisioned.

deploy key for kajof-yawif: bky9_fvxrpdHPq